What separates a great NES emulator from a mediocre one? Consider these key factors:
- Compatibility: Does it support your Android version and the ROMs you want to play? Incompatibility leads to frustration, not fun.
- Performance: Look for reviews mentioning "smooth," "fast," and "stable" performance. Lag ruins the retro experience.
- Features: Save states (pause and resume anytime), cheat codes (for those tricky moments), and controller support (far superior to touchscreen controls) are highly desirable.
- User Interface: A clean, intuitive interface is crucial. A clunky design quickly turns nostalgia into frustration.
Top NES Emulator APKs: A Head-to-Head Comparison
Several popular emulators compete for your attention. Here's a comparative analysis:
| Emulator Name | Pros | Cons | Ideal User |
|---|---|---|---|
| RetroArch | Highly customizable, supports numerous systems, powerful emulation | Steeper learning curve, complex for casual users | Advanced users seeking extensive customization |
| Nesoid | Simple, user-friendly interface, excellent for beginners | Fewer features compared to others | Casual users prioritizing ease of use |
| John NESS Emulator | Solid performance, generally accurate emulation | Controller support may be less comprehensive than competitors | Users needing a balance of features and ease of use |
Remember, "best" depends on your preferences. Nesoid suits beginners, while RetroArch appeals to customization enthusiasts.
Installing Your Chosen Emulator: A Step-by-Step Guide
Once you've selected your emulator, installation is typically straightforward:
- Download: Download the APK from a trustworthy app store.
- Permissions: Your device might require enabling installation from "unknown sources" (found in security settings). This is safe if you’ve downloaded from a reputable source.
- Install: Locate the downloaded APK and install it.
- Launch: Follow any on-screen instructions; you're ready to play!

Improving Emulator Accuracy: Fine-Tuning for Specific Titles
Even the best emulators benefit from fine-tuning for specific games. Accuracy hinges on several factors:
- Emulator Choice: The emulator's core significantly impacts accuracy; experiment with different cores if available.
- Configuration: Adjust video (scaling filters), audio, and CPU/GPU settings for optimal results. Integer scaling offers the most accurate, if not upscaled, visuals.
- ROM Integrity: A corrupt ROM leads to issues; ensure you've downloaded a clean ROM.
- Community Support: Forums offer troubleshooting assistance for specific game compatibility problems.
